Language learning plays a crucial role in personal and professional growth, opening doors to new opportunities and fostering better cross-cultural understanding. In recent years, there has been a significant rise in the interest to learn Marathi, a rich and vibrant language spoken by millions in the Indian state of Maharashtra. As technology continues to advance, mobile apps have become invaluable tools for language acquisition, providing accessible and convenient ways to learn on the go. In this article, we will explore the best app to learn Marathi and delve into the various aspects that make it an ideal choice for language learners.

Understanding the Marathi Language

Marathi is an Indo-Aryan language that holds a significant place in Indian culture and history. With its origins dating back to the 8th century, Marathi has evolved into a rich and diverse language spoken primarily in the western Indian state of Maharashtra. Here are some key points to help you understand the history, significance, and regional influence of the Marathi language:

  1. History and Significance: Marathi has a rich literary heritage that dates back centuries, with notable contributions from influential poets and writers. It emerged as an independent language during the medieval period and gained prominence during the reign of the Maratha Empire in the 17th and 18th centuries. Marathi played a pivotal role in social and cultural movements, shaping the identity and ethos of the people of Maharashtra.
  2. Regional Influence: Marathi is the official language of Maharashtra and is also spoken in the neighboring states of Goa, Gujarat, Karnataka, Telangana, and Madhya Pradesh. The language has a strong cultural influence in various aspects, including literature, cinema, music, and theater. Understanding Marathi opens doors to exploring the vibrant cultural heritage and traditions of Maharashtra.
  3. Interesting Facts:
  • Marathi is written in the Devanagari script, which is also used for languages like Hindi, Sanskrit, and Nepali.
  • It is the 19th most spoken language in the world, with over 83 million native speakers.
  • Marathi has a rich vocabulary, with words derived from Sanskrit, Prakrit, Persian, Arabic, and other languages.
  • The language has diverse dialects across different regions of Maharashtra, each with its unique characteristics and pronunciation.

Marathi language and its speakers are known for their warm hospitality, vibrant festivals, and strong community bonds. By exploring the history, significance, and interesting facets of Marathi, learners can gain a deeper appreciation for the language and its cultural heritage.

Benefits of Learning Marathi through Mobile Apps

Learning Marathi through mobile apps offers numerous advantages that make language acquisition more convenient, engaging, and effective. Here are the key benefits of using mobile apps to learn Marathi:

  1. Convenience and Flexibility of Mobile Learning: Mobile apps provide the flexibility to learn Marathi anytime and anywhere. Learners can access lessons, practice exercises, and resources conveniently from their smartphones or tablets. Whether you’re commuting, taking a break, or waiting in line, you can make the most of your idle time by engaging with the app and progressing in your language learning journey.
  2. Access to a Wide Range of Learning Resources: Marathi learning apps offer a vast array of resources designed to cater to different proficiency levels. From beginner to advanced, you can access lessons, vocabulary lists, grammar explanations, audio recordings, and interactive exercises at your fingertips. These comprehensive resources provide a structured and systematic approach to learning Marathi, ensuring a well-rounded language learning experience.
  3. Interactive Features for Enhanced Engagement: Mobile apps incorporate interactive features that enhance engagement and make learning Marathi enjoyable. These features may include gamified exercises, quizzes, flashcards, and interactive dialogues. By actively participating in these interactive activities, learners can practice their listening, speaking, reading, and writing skills, promoting a deeper understanding and retention of the language.
  4. Personalized Learning Experience: Many Marathi learning apps offer personalized learning paths based on individual progress and goals. These apps track your performance, identify areas for improvement, and provide tailored recommendations to optimize your learning experience. Personalization allows learners to focus on specific language skills or topics, ensuring efficient and targeted language acquisition.
  5. Audio and Pronunciation Practice: Mobile apps often incorporate audio recordings by native Marathi speakers, allowing learners to practice their pronunciation and listening comprehension. Through interactive pronunciation exercises and voice recognition technology, learners can refine their accent and intonation, developing more authentic Marathi speaking skills.
  6. Progress Tracking and Motivation: Marathi learning apps usually include progress tracking features that monitor your learning journey. These features provide visual representations of your achievements, such as badges, scores, or progress bars, fostering a sense of accomplishment and motivation. Regular feedback and milestones can inspire learners to stay motivated and continue their language learning efforts.

By utilizing mobile apps for Marathi language learning, learners can benefit from the convenience, access to diverse resources, interactive engagement, personalized learning, pronunciation practice, and progress tracking features. These advantages make mobile apps an excellent tool for mastering the Marathi language.

Criteria for Evaluating the Best App to Learn Marathi

When searching for the best app to learn Marathi, it’s essential to consider specific criteria that contribute to an effective and enjoyable learning experience. Here are the key factors to evaluate when selecting a Marathi learning app:

  1. User-Friendly Interface and Navigation: A user-friendly interface and intuitive navigation are vital for a seamless learning experience. The app should have a clean and organized layout, making it easy to navigate between lessons, exercises, and resources. Clear instructions, intuitive icons, and logical menu structures contribute to a smooth and user-friendly interface.
  2. Comprehensive Content and Curriculum: The best Marathi learning app should offer comprehensive content and a well-structured curriculum. It should cover essential language skills, including listening, speaking, reading, and writing, with a focus on vocabulary, grammar, and pronunciation. A wide range of topics and real-life situations should be included to facilitate practical language use.
  3. Gamification and Interactive Exercises: Gamification elements, such as badges, rewards, and challenges, enhance user engagement and motivation. Interactive exercises, quizzes, and games make learning Marathi enjoyable and encourage active participation. Look for an app that incorporates interactive features to practice language skills, reinforce concepts, and apply knowledge in a fun and interactive manner.
  4. Progress Tracking and Personalized Learning Paths: An effective Marathi learning app should have built-in progress tracking features. Learners should be able to monitor their performance, track their achievements, and identify areas for improvement. The app should also offer personalized learning paths based on individual strengths, weaknesses, and learning goals. Adaptive learning algorithms can provide tailored recommendations for optimized learning.
  5. Multimedia Resources: A high-quality Marathi learning app should incorporate multimedia resources, such as audio recordings, videos, and interactive visuals. These resources enhance listening comprehension, expose learners to natural language use, and provide cultural context. Multimedia elements contribute to a more immersive and authentic learning experience.

When evaluating Marathi learning apps, consider the user-friendly interface, comprehensive content, gamification features, progress tracking capabilities, and the presence of multimedia resources. By selecting an app that meets these criteria, learners can maximize their language learning potential and enjoy a rewarding journey towards mastering Marathi.

Top Recommendations: Best App to Learn Marathi

App 1: Marathi Mastery

  1. Overview of the app’s features and benefits: Marathi Mastery is a comprehensive language learning app designed to help users master Marathi effectively. It offers a wide range of features and benefits, including:
  • Structured curriculum covering vocabulary, grammar, speaking, listening, and reading skills.
  • Interactive lessons with clear explanations and examples.
  • Practice exercises to reinforce learning and assess progress.
  • Cultural insights and real-life dialogues for practical language use.
  • Offline access to lessons and resources for learning on the go.
  1. Positive user reviews and ratings: Marathi Mastery has garnered positive reviews and high ratings from its users. Learners appreciate its user-friendly interface, well-organized content, and effective teaching methods. Many users have reported significant improvements in their Marathi language skills after using the app.
  2. Interactive lessons and quizzes: The app offers interactive lessons that engage learners through various multimedia elements, such as audio recordings, videos, and interactive exercises. These interactive components enhance comprehension, pronunciation, and overall language proficiency. Quizzes and assessments provide opportunities for learners to test their knowledge and track their progress.
  3. Language immersion through multimedia resources: Marathi Mastery provides a rich immersion experience through multimedia resources. Users can access audio recordings of native Marathi speakers, videos showcasing cultural aspects, and authentic materials that expose learners to real-life language usage. This immersion approach enhances language acquisition and cultural understanding.

App 2: Marathi Guru

Introduction to the app’s key features: Marathi Guru is a highly regarded app for learning Marathi. Its key features include:

  • Comprehensive curriculum covering vocabulary, grammar, and sentence structure.
  • Step-by-step lessons with clear explanations and examples.
  • Progress tracking to monitor learning achievements.
  • User-friendly interface and intuitive navigation.

Unique selling points and advantages: Marathi Guru stands out due to its unique selling points and advantages, such as:

  • Focus on building conversational skills and practical language use.
  • Extensive vocabulary building exercises and flashcards.
  • Audio recordings for pronunciation practice and improving listening skills.
  • Voice recognition technology to assess and provide feedback on pronunciation accuracy.
  1. Pronunciation practice and voice recognition: Marathi Guru places significant emphasis on pronunciation practice. It offers exercises and activities to help learners develop accurate pronunciation. The app utilizes voice recognition technology to provide feedback and assistance in improving pronunciation skills.
  2. Vocabulary building exercises and flashcards: Marathi Guru provides a variety of vocabulary building exercises and interactive flashcards. These resources aid in expanding vocabulary and reinforcing word retention. Learners can practice and review vocabulary through interactive exercises, enhancing their language proficiency.

Both Marathi Mastery and Marathi Guru are highly recommended apps for learning Marathi. They offer interactive lessons, user-friendly interfaces, and comprehensive content to support learners at various proficiency levels. With their unique features, engaging exercises, and focus on practical language use, these apps can assist learners in acquiring a solid foundation in the Marathi language.

Success Stories: Real-life Experiences with Marathi Learning Apps

Real-life success stories and experiences from learners who have used Marathi learning apps can provide valuable insights into the effectiveness of these apps. Here are two key aspects to consider when examining success stories:

  1. User Testimonials and Case Studies Showcasing App Effectiveness: Marathi learning apps often feature user testimonials and case studies highlighting the positive impact of the app on language learning. These testimonials and case studies can shed light on the experiences and achievements of learners who have used the app. They may discuss how the app helped them overcome challenges, improve their language skills, and achieve their language learning goals. Look for apps that have a collection of authentic testimonials and well-documented case studies to validate their effectiveness.
  2. Statistical Data on Language Proficiency Improvements: Marathi learning apps may also provide statistical data on language proficiency improvements among their users. This data could include information on the average increase in vocabulary, grammar knowledge, speaking fluency, or reading comprehension. It may also highlight the percentage of learners who achieved certain language milestones or proficiency levels after using the app. Statistical data can provide tangible evidence of the app’s effectiveness and its impact on language acquisition.

When researching Marathi learning apps, pay attention to user testimonials and case studies that showcase the positive experiences and achievements of learners. Additionally, look for apps that provide statistical data on language proficiency improvements, as this data can offer quantifiable evidence of the app’s effectiveness in helping learners master the Marathi language.

Tips for Maximizing Learning with Marathi Apps

To make the most of your language learning journey with Marathi apps, here are some helpful tips to enhance your progress and optimize your learning experience:

  1. Set Achievable Goals and Create a Study Schedule: Establish clear and achievable language learning goals. Whether it’s mastering a specific number of vocabulary words or improving your conversational skills, setting goals helps you stay motivated and focused. Create a study schedule that fits your routine and dedicate regular time slots for learning Marathi. Consistency is key in language acquisition.
  2. Utilize Supplementary Resources such as Dictionaries and Grammar Guides: While Marathi apps provide comprehensive content, don’t hesitate to use supplementary resources such as dictionaries and grammar guides. These resources can deepen your understanding of vocabulary, grammar rules, and sentence structure. They serve as valuable references when you encounter unfamiliar words or need clarification on grammar concepts.
  3. Practice Speaking with Native Marathi Speakers or Language Exchange Partners: One of the best ways to improve your speaking skills is by practicing with native Marathi speakers. Seek out language exchange partners or join online language communities where you can engage in conversation and practice speaking in a supportive environment. Many Marathi learning apps also offer voice chat features or connect learners with native speakers, providing opportunities for language practice and cultural exchange.
  4. Engage with Interactive Features of the App: Make full use of the interactive features offered by the Marathi learning app. Engage in interactive exercises, quizzes, and dialogues to reinforce your language skills. Take advantage of pronunciation practice, speech recognition, and other interactive elements to improve your accent and fluency. Active participation in app activities enhances your learning experience and retention.
  5. Embrace Immersion through Media and Cultural Resources: Immerse yourself in Marathi language and culture by exploring additional media resources. Listen to Marathi songs, podcasts, or watch movies, TV shows, or videos in Marathi. This exposure to authentic language use and cultural context can enhance your comprehension, vocabulary, and cultural understanding.
  6. Review and Revise Regularly: Regularly review the lessons and materials you have covered in the Marathi learning app. Spaced repetition is an effective learning technique that helps reinforce knowledge and improve retention. Set aside time to revise previously learned content to solidify your understanding and ensure long-term language proficiency.

By incorporating these tips into your language learning routine with Marathi apps, you can maximize your learning potential, develop a strong foundation in the language, and progress towards fluency in Marathi.

Overcoming Challenges in Marathi Language Learning

Learning any language comes with its own set of challenges, and Marathi is no exception. Here are some common difficulties faced by learners and strategies to overcome hurdles related to pronunciation, grammar, and vocabulary in Marathi language learning:

  1. Common Difficulties Faced by Learners:
    a. Pronunciation: Marathi has distinct phonetic sounds that may be unfamiliar to non-native speakers. Pronouncing certain sounds, such as retroflex consonants or nasal vowels, can pose challenges.
    b. Grammar: Marathi has a complex grammatical structure, including verb conjugation, noun declension, and sentence formation, which can be challenging for learners.
    c. Vocabulary: Memorizing new vocabulary words and their meanings, especially when they differ significantly from one’s native language, can be demanding.
  2. Strategies to Overcome Pronunciation Hurdles:
    a. Listen and Repeat: Listen to native Marathi speakers and practice imitating their pronunciation. Repeat words and phrases to improve your accent and intonation.
    b. Use Audio Resources: Utilize audio recordings available in Marathi learning apps or other resources to practice pronunciation. Pay attention to the correct pronunciation and rhythm.
    c. Seek Feedback: Engage with native speakers or language exchange partners who can provide feedback on your pronunciation. This helps you identify areas for improvement and refine your skills.
  3. Strategies to Overcome Grammar Challenges:
    a. Study Grammar Rules: Devote time to understanding the grammar rules of Marathi. Use grammar guides or resources specific to Marathi to grasp the intricacies of verb conjugation, noun declension, and sentence structure.
    b. Practice with Exercises: Complete grammar exercises in Marathi learning apps or workbooks to reinforce your understanding and application of grammar rules.
    c. Seek Clarification: If you come across grammar concepts that confuse you, don’t hesitate to ask questions or seek clarification from teachers, tutors, or online language forums.
  4. Strategies to Overcome Vocabulary Hurdles:
    a. Contextual Learning: Learn vocabulary in context by studying words within sentences or phrases. This helps you understand their meaning and usage in practical situations.
    b. Flashcards and Repetition: Use flashcards to review and memorize new vocabulary words. Regularly revise and practice the words to reinforce your memory.
    c. Use Vocabulary in Context: Incorporate new vocabulary into your speaking and writing practice. Use the words in sentences to reinforce their usage and increase familiarity.

Remember, language learning takes time and consistent effort. Embrace challenges as opportunities for growth and persevere in your language learning journey. With determination, practice, and the right strategies, you can overcome pronunciation, grammar, and vocabulary hurdles in Marathi language learning.

Maintaining Language Learning Habits

Building and maintaining consistent language learning habits are essential for long-term progress and proficiency in Marathi. Here are some tips to help you maintain your language learning habits:

  1. Incorporating Regular Practice into Daily Routines: Make language learning a part of your daily routine. Dedicate a specific time each day to practice Marathi, whether it’s in the morning, during lunch breaks, or in the evening. Consistency is key, even if you can only spare a few minutes each day. This regular practice helps reinforce your learning and keeps your language skills sharp.
  2. Creating a Supportive and Immersive Learning Environment: Immerse yourself in the Marathi language as much as possible to create a supportive learning environment. Here’s how:
  • Surround yourself with Marathi resources such as books, newspapers, podcasts, or music.
  • Change the language settings on your devices and social media platforms to Marathi.
  • Engage with Marathi-speaking communities or language exchange partners to practice conversational skills.

Leveraging App Features for Ongoing Skill Development: Marathi learning apps offer various features to support ongoing skill development. Here’s how you can make the most of them:

  • Set daily or weekly goals within the app to track your progress and maintain motivation.
  • Utilize the app’s practice exercises, quizzes, and games to reinforce your knowledge and skills.
  • Take advantage of app features like flashcards, vocabulary builders, or grammar exercises for focused practice.

Varying Learning Methods and Materials: To keep your language learning engaging and interesting, vary your learning methods and materials. This prevents monotony and keeps you motivated. Here are some ideas:

  • Explore different types of content, such as articles, videos, podcasts, or movies, to expose yourself to different language contexts.
  • Try learning from different sources or apps to gain diverse perspectives and approaches to language learning.
  • Incorporate activities like writing in a journal, participating in online language challenges, or joining virtual language meetups to expand your skills.

Setting Realistic Goals and Tracking Progress: Set achievable and realistic goals for your language learning journey. Break down larger goals into smaller milestones, making them more attainable. Track your progress regularly, noting the improvements you’ve made along the way. Celebrate your achievements, no matter how small, to stay motivated and maintain a positive mindset.

Remember, consistency and perseverance are key when maintaining language learning habits. By incorporating regular practice into your daily routines, creating an immersive learning environment, leveraging app features, and setting realistic goals, you can develop a strong foundation in Marathi and continue progressing towards language fluency.


Learning Marathi is a valuable endeavor that opens doors to new cultural experiences, personal growth, and professional opportunities. In this article, we explored the importance of learning Marathi and how mobile apps can greatly facilitate language acquisition.

Marathi learning apps offer the convenience, flexibility, and comprehensive resources needed to master the language effectively. Among the top recommendations discussed were “Marathi Mastery” and “Marathi Guru,” which provide interactive lessons, personalized learning paths, and a focus on practical language use.

To maximize your language learning journey, we provided tips on setting achievable goals, utilizing supplementary resources, practicing with native speakers, and engaging with interactive app features. Overcoming challenges in pronunciation, grammar, and vocabulary is possible through dedicated practice and strategic learning techniques.

In conclusion, we encourage you to embark on your Marathi language learning journey using mobile apps. The combination of convenience, comprehensive resources, and interactive features makes these apps invaluable tools for achieving fluency in Marathi. Embrace the opportunity to explore the rich culture and heritage associated with the Marathi language.

Start your language learning journey today and watch as you make progress, gain confidence, and unlock new doors through the power of Marathi language acquisition.


